    AMANA ACADEMY, INC.

    Job Location: West Atlanta Campus

    Amana’s lower elementary program fosters students’ curiosity for learning by providing authentic, integrated contexts for active learning through fieldwork with community partners, civic leaders, industry and business figures, and environmental scientists. Teacher’s value multiple approaches to the learning process and create hands-on and cooperative learning experiences. Social-emotional learning, creativity and critical thinking, service learning and curriculum that emphasizes science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) is at the core of the lower elementary program. Teachers in grades K-3 loop with their students to foster community and relationships that allow for a nurturing learning environment. The ideal teacher for this position is passionate about working with gifted elementary school students, committed to innovative pedagogy, and demonstrates a personal commitment to lifelong learning. The candidate must have experience developing project-based curriculum with a team and with or without textbooks; have a command of concept-based mathematics instruction; and have the ability to develop students in areas of social-emotional learning. Amana delivers gifted instruction through a collaborative approach.

    HOW YOU WILL EMPOWER STUDENTS TO GO BEYOND

    • Teach courses of study expertly with the highest standards for each student
    • Convey enthusiasm for content and intellectual inquiry and high-quality work
    • Design instruction that emphasizes critical thinking and problem-solving using the engineering design process
    • Collaborate with colleagues and departments to enrich curriculum and instruction
    • Integrate appropriate technology to enhance learning in a BYOD environment
    • Create hands-on, project-based learning experiences with real-world applications and authentic service learning
    • Collaborate effectively with students, teachers, and parents
    • Model flexibility in implementing best learning practices
    • Support the well-being of all students
    • Support the culture/character building through research-based structures such as CREW
    • Demonstrate interest and ability to lead student activities, coach, and contribute beyond the classroom
    • Lead by example in your commitment to Amana’s mission

    WHAT YOU NEED TO SUCCEED

    • All positions require a minimum of bachelor’s degree and valid, current Georgia teaching certification in ESOL for this position.
    • Experience in a progressive, constructivist, and/or gifted education setting is desired. STEM-based, STEAM-based, and/or project-based learning (PBL) experience is preferred.
    • Teaching certification must be held in the state of Georgia or have active reciprocity with Georgia. Please visit or call the Georgia Professional Standards Commission to verify.
    • Preference will be given to teachers with 3 or more years of demonstrated excellence in teaching.
